ABOUT THIS WINE
Trizanne Chardonnay 'Benede-Duivenshokrivier' from the Cape South Coast is a truly exceptional wine that embodies the spirit of innovation and the beauty of its unique terroir. This vineyard, located in the remarkable ward of Lower Duivenhoks River—situated between Riversdale, Vermaaklikheid, and Heidelberg—benefits from its proximity to the ocean, which plays a vital role in defining its climate. The limestone soils, combined with cool mean ripening temperatures, create the perfect conditions for producing a mineral-driven Chardonnay that stands out in South African winemaking.

Grapes for the Benede-Duivenshokrivier Chardonnay are carefully sourced and whole bunch pressed, allowing the fruit to express its true character without manipulation. The fermentation process is conducted naturally in a combination of partly new, second, and third-fill French oak barrels, further enhancing the wine's complexity. Notably, there is no malolactic fermentation, preserving the fresh acidity and natural elegance of the Chardonnay.

On the nose, this wine reveals a captivating bouquet layered with bright citrus and apple notes, complemented by a steely minerality that creates a perfect tension. The aromatic complexity invites further exploration, setting the stage for a delightful tasting experience.

On the palate, the Trizanne Chardonnay is supremely elegant, with a beautifully balanced natural acidity that lends the wine both longevity and a vibrant punch. The flavours are well-defined, showcasing layers of fruit and minerality that harmonise effortlessly.

With only 1,800 bottles produced, this limited release is a true gem, reflecting the dedication and passion of winemaker Trizanne Barnett. The impressive long finish leaves a lasting impression, reaffirming the wine's character and quality. Perfect for pairing with seafood, grilled vegetables, or light poultry dishes, Trizanne Chardonnay 'Benede-Duivenshokrivier' is a sophisticated choice for those seeking a refined and memorable wine experience that highlights the best of South African Chardonnay.

THE WINE ADVOCATE 92 points
Reviewed by: Anthony Mueller
Drink Date: 2023 - 2033
Mineral-driven, with waxy elements, lemon rind and hints of honeydew melon, the 2022 Benede-Duivenshokrivier Chardonnay displays lemon yogurt aromas with elements of white peach skin and yellow apples. Light to medium-bodied and with 12% alcohol, the mineral-driven palate has succulent acidity that will remain fresh for another decade. This delightful Chardonnay concludes with a fresh, vibrant, food-friendly finish that has me returning for more. Only 1,601 bottles were produced from Chardonnay grown on limestone soils.
